      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/270126"&gt;@Ng11111&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;1 get a new PM sim from Telus or Koodo store&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;2. open ticket with PM to sort out My account login&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;3. login to My Account and use Change Sim card to tie the new sim card with you old phone number, confirm it works&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;4. get the account number from My Account&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;5. request porting from bell provide them PM account number&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;6. put PM SIM card back in a phone and reply Yes to the port authorization text&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
